Driving on the way up to Mammoth Mt in California on highway 395 is a peculiar town called Kramer’s Junction . It’s just an intersection of 2 roads and there is a restaurant with a bright yellow sign that says “RESTAURANT”.
Anyhow this when the food blog started. At times the most memorable events of a vacation or any day in life is related to a meal.

Southern Fried Chicken Dinner with side of mash potatoes and Honey Butter Muffins.
It sounded a lot better than it tasted. The fried chicken was soggy and the batter was not very fresh and not crispy at all. It no West Harlem Fried Chicken for sure!
